Changing Shortcuts

You can change the settings in a Shortcut.
a
Press
b
Press a tab from 1 to 8 to display the
Shortcut you want to change.
c
Press the Shortcut you want. The
settings for the Shortcut that you chose
are displayed.
d
Change the settings for the Shortcut you
chose in step c (for more information,
see Shortcut Settings on page 13).
e
When you have finished changing
settings, press Save as Shortcut.
f
Press OK to confirm.
g
Do one of the following:
To overwrite the Shortcut, press
Yes. Go to step i.
If you do not want to overwrite the
Shortcut, press No to enter a new
Shortcut name. Go to step h.
